Berkeley People's Alliance v. City of Berkeley

Zoning ordinance limiting unrelated individuals in homes upheld

calctapp · 2026-01-15 · Defendant Win · Impact: 45/100

Berkeley People's Alliance v. City of Berkeley, decided by California Court of Appeal on January 15, 2026, resulted in a defendant win outcome. The Berkeley People's Alliance challenged the City of Be...
